Figure 02 · Best for

Sheet-metal loading in automotive assembly — 2-second cycle precision on BMW X3 production line, 90,000+ parts handled in 11-month pilot

TORA ONE · Best for

Precision component assembly with tactile feedback in electronics or semiconductor manufacturing.
